Intro

This chapter explores the philosophical differences between happiness and pleasure, contrasting classical utilitarianism with modern psychological perspectives. It highlights how happiness reflects overall life satisfaction, while pleasure represents fleeting experiences, suggesting the potential for experiencing one without the other.
